Who we are

In 2017, Paigelynn Trotter began offering goat and sheep grazing services in collaboration with other livestock owners. Five years later, the business evolved into a family run outfit named Coastal Land and Livestock.

Now, the Coastal team of women, dogs and a herd of cashmere goats migrates between Mendocino and Sonoma Counties, offering adaptive grazing services based o n the lands seasonal vegetation needs.

The Coastal team focuses on learning how to best apply low-stress livestock handling principles to all their work with small ruminants. We hope to be advocates for this style of handling and support the expansion of safe and humane stockmanship education.
